﻿html {color:#595644; background: url(bg.png) repeat-x center top #534b38; height:100%;}
body{background: url(head.jpg) center 32px no-repeat;}
a{ color: #069; }
a:hover{ color: #09C; }

.light_tx,.light_txt2,.comment_post_form_box .ctrl{color:#999;}
.red,.gbook_con ol li .replay_box .reply_self{color:#cc0000;}
.it_s{border-color:#979797;}
.it1{border-color:#fff;background-color:#fff;border-left-color:#000; border-top-color:#000}
.toolbar{color:#eee;border:0;height:31px; background:none; overflow:hidden;}
.toolbar a{color:#eee;}
.html{width:802px; position:relative; zoom:1;}
.p_full{background: url(body.png) top left repeat-y; zoom:1; padding-left:5px;}
.header {height:413px;}
.header .left{left:25px; top:40px; font-size:28px; font-family:"\5FAE\8F6F\96C5\9ED1";font-weight:900; color:#1f724c;}
.header .side{left:28px; top:83px; font-size:12px; color:#6bc071;}

.menu{ position:absolute; left:30px; top:128px; width:600px; border:none; height:29px; padding:0; }
.menu li {display: inline-block;padding:0 5px;margin:0;float:left;text-align:center;width:auto;height:auto;border:none;}

.menu .loveinfo_menu{ margin-right:10px;}
.menu li a{display:inline-block; padding:2px 6px 0 6px; height:29px; line-height:29px; overflow:hidden; color:#f0eeb6;}
.menu .selected{}
.menu .index_menu a,.menu .loveinfo_menu a{font-size:14px; width:83px; padding:0; background:url(tab.png) right 0; color:#f0eeb6;}
.menu .index_menu a:hover,.menu .loveinfo_menu a:hover,
.menu .selected a,.menu .selected a:hover{ background:url(tab.png) left 0; color:#111;}
.diary_menu a,.photo_menu a,.music_menu a,.share_menu a,.friend_menu a{background:none!important;font-weight: bold!important;}

.p_full_diary .selected a,
.p_full_diary_view .selected a,
.p_full_music .selected a,
.p_full_photo .selected a,
.p_full_share .selected a,
.p_full_friend .selected a{ font-weight:bold!important; color:#ffcc00!important; background:url(on.png) center bottom no-repeat!important;}

.p_full {padding:0px;}

.p_full div.p_left,.p_full  div.p_right {width:255px; padding:10px 0 0 0; float:right;}
.p_full div.p_left {margin:0 0 0 0; position:relative;}
.p_full div.p_left img{border:1px solid #a5a5a5; background:#fff;}
.p_full .userinfo .info_mes img,.p_full .gift img{border:0; background:none;}
.p_full div.p_left .head{ height:32px;line-height:16px; background:#b8cfdc; color:#111; margin:0 10px 0 2px; padding:0 5px;}
.p_full div.p_left .pane{zoom:1; padding:0;}
.p_full div.p_left .pane .body{ padding:10px 14px 10px 6px;overflow:hidden; width:235px; }
.p_full div.p_left .pane:after{clear:both; height:0; overflow:hidden; display:block; visibility:hidden; content:".";}


.grid_2 .p_main {
float:left;
width:535px; overflow:hidden;
padding:3px 0 0 5px;
background:none;
}
.grid_1 .p_main{
width:785px; overflow:hidden;
padding:3px 0 0 5px;
background:none;
}
.grid_1 .p_full{ background-image: url(body1.png);}
.grid_1 .foot{ background-image: url(footer1.png);}

.p_full .p_main .head{color:#111; height:39px; line-height:26px; border-bottom:1px solid #999;  padding:0 5px; margin:0 10px;}
.p_full .p_main .head .text{ font-size:18px;}
.p_full .p_main .rect{padding:0;}
.p_full .p_main .pane{}
.p_full .p_main .pane .body{padding:10px 20px 20px 20px;}

.txtright{padding:0 0 15px 0;}
.txtright a,.txtright a:hover{font-size:14px; text-decoration:underline; font-weight:bold;}
.p_main .head .more{font-weight:bold;}


.foot{height:18px; line-height:18px; text-align: center; padding:60px 0 25px 0; color:#ae9f6d; background: url(footer.png) center 0 no-repeat;} .foot a{color:#ae9f6d;}
.foot .foot_text{border-color:#ae9f6d;}

.p_full .p_main .rect{}
.p_full_photo .p_main .pane,
.p_full_loveinfo .p_main .pane,
.p_full_gbook .p_main .pane,
.p_full_friend .p_main .pane
{background:none;}
.rect .body {}
.rect .head .tab{padding-top:11px;_padding-top:16px;}
.rect .head .tab li{padding:4px 15px 0 15px; position: relative; margin-bottom:-1px;}
.rect .head .tab li.currrent{border:1px solid #999; border-bottom:0;  background:#fff; color:#111;}
.pane{padding-bottom:4px;}
.gbook_con ol li .username,.gbook_con ol li .date{color:#666;}
.gbook_con ol li .con{color:#333;}
.gbook_con .morecommend{width:87%;}
.updateblock{border-color:#b2b2b2;}
.updateblock ul li{border-color:#17558e;}
.updateblock .time{color:#828282;}
.page_bar .pagination_txt,.page_bar .pagination a{background:#216489;color:#fff;} 
.page_bar .pagination .current {background:#d3d3d3;color:#216489;}
.small_page_bar .pagination a{background:none;color:#216489;}
.small_page_bar .pagination .current{background:none;color:#515151;}
.diary_box .commend{border-color:#b2b2b2;}
.diary_share ol li,.diary_share ol li a{color:#111;}
.photo_catalog_list li{color:#707070;}
.photo_flash,.music_playlist{background:#fff;}

.music_playlist li.current{background:#E7F0FA;}


.lyso_pop{width:300px; line-height:22px;}
.grid_1 .p_note_main{ line-height:20px; padding:10px 30px;}
.updateblock{width:auto;}
.friend_list .mes{width:350px;}
.friend_list .photo{border:1px solid #ccc}